Link Layer Settings

1.

Data Link Address (Device DNP address)

-

Range: 0 to 65519 (default address = 1)

2.

Data Link Layer Confirmation

-

Select between NEVER/SOMETIMES/ALWAYS (default is NEVER. DNP over Ethernet
should always be NEVER.)

Application Layer Settings

1.

Application response fragment size

-

Range: 240 to 4096 (default size = 2048)

2.

Application confirmation timeout

-

Range: 1 to 2678400000 ms (default value = 5000 ms)

Time Synchronization Support Setting

Time synchronization is disabled by default (setting value = 0). Time synchronization should always be
disabled for DNP over Ethernet. Range is from 0 to 2678400000 ms. DNP synch time will affect the
device time based on Time Priority Setup. If not selected in Time Priority Setup settings list (DNP Priority
= 0), DNP sync time will not be used to synchronize device time. Clock setup is configurable using
BESTCOMSPlus and the front panel interface.

Unsolicited Response Support Settings

1.

Unsolicited support DISABLED/ENABLED

-

The DNP Unsolicited Response Function should be “Disabled” for RS-485 applications
since there is no collision avoidance mechanism.

2.

Master Data Link Address (DNP Unsolicited Response Destination Address)

-

Range: 0 to 65519 (default address = 5)

3.

Unsolicited Response Confirmation Timeout in ms

-

Range: 0 to 2678400000 ms. When setting = 0, the value is the same as setting for
Application Confirmation Timeout.

4.

Number of unsolicited retries

-

Range: 0 to 255 (default = 2)

5.

Unsolicited off-line interval in ms

-

Range: 0 to 2678400000 ms (default = 10000 (10 seconds))

6.

Unsolicited response trigger conditions

-

Number of Class 1 events (range from 1 to 100)

-

Number of Class 2 events (range from 1 to 100)

-

Number of Class 3 events (range from 1 to 100)

Objects Default Variations Settings

1.

Default variation for Binary Input (Object 1)

-

Range: 1 or 2 (default = 1)

2.

Default variation for Binary Input Change (Object 2)

-

Range: 1 or 2 (default = 2 (with time))

3.

Default variation for Analog Input (Object 30)

-

Range: 1, 2, 3, 4, or 5 (default = 3 (32-bit without flag))

4.

Default variation for Analog Input Change (Object 32)

-

Range: 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, or 7 (default = 1 (32-bit without time))
